There are three things holding this back from
being the only tune to buy.

1. 4 Bar map sensor. (You do them for 992)
2. 718 GTS 2.5 Litre injectors.
3. Flex Fuel (Mitch has done many others)


For the growing number of 991.2 with Up graded turbo’s we are out of Injector Duty Cycle.

The 718 GTS 2.5 Litre injectors should fit our car. Thats being confirmed shortly. That will give us the headroom for a decent E85 tune. The 4 bar map sensors break us free of 29psi, and flex fuel puts convenience back into the mix.
